Utilizing digital color management in powder coatings eliminates data silos, ultimately resulting in faster, more-accurate matching. Digital color management gives manufacturers confidence in their color quality, knowing they have obtained it quickly and cost effectively.
The adoption of digital color measurement and communication can have a positive impact across the supply chain for many industries – resulting in a significant reduction in time and costs associated with product development – and the paint and coatings industry is no different.
